## Day 1: Arrival in Beijing
- Morning: Arrive in Beijing. Check into your hotel and freshen up.
- Afternoon: Take a leisurely stroll around Tiananmen Square. It’s the largest public square in the world and a great introduction to the city.
- Evening: Visit the Forbidden City (Palace Museum). It’s best to go in the late afternoon to avoid crowds. Don’t forget to take lots of photos!
- Dinner: Try some local cuisine at a nearby restaurant. Peking duck is a must!
## Day 2: The Great Wall
- Morning: Head out early to the Great Wall of China. I recommend the Mutianyu section for its stunning views and fewer crowds. You can hike or take a cable car up.
- Afternoon: Enjoy a picnic lunch on the wall or at a nearby restaurant. Spend some time exploring the wall and taking in the breathtaking scenery.
- Evening: Return to Beijing and relax. Maybe catch a traditional Peking opera performance if you’re up for it!

## Day 5: Art District and Shopping
- Morning: Explore the 798 Art District, a hub for contemporary art and culture. Check out galleries and quirky shops.
- Afternoon: Head to Wangfujing Street for some shopping. Don’t miss the food stalls for some unique snacks!
- Evening: Enjoy a night out in the area. You could try a local bar or café.
## Day 6: Day Trip to Chengde
- All ## Day: Take a day trip to Chengde, about 3 hours from Beijing. Visit the Chengde Mountain Resort and the surrounding temples. It’s a UNESCO World Heritage site and offers beautiful landscapes.
- Evening: Return to Beijing and relax after a long day.

## Day 8: National Museum and Olympic Park
- Morning: Visit the National Museum of China. It’s vast and covers a lot of Chinese history and culture.
- Afternoon: Head to Olympic Park to see the Bird’s Nest and Water Cube. You can take a stroll around the park and enjoy the architecture.
- Evening: Have dinner in the area and enjoy the night views of the Olympic structures.

Tips:
- Transportation: Use the subway for efficient travel around the city. It’s clean, safe, and easy to navigate.
- Language: While many signs are in English, learning a few basic Mandarin phrases can be helpful and appreciated by locals.
- Cash: Have some cash on hand, as not all places accept credit cards.
